Any digital downloads will be linked with the Xbox as well as the profile. Until the previous owner deletes the Xbox from the account it is still likely to load and play while you are connected online. I have an old Xbox 360 which I gave to a friend without my profile but still linked as a device on my account. All of the digital games I had on the hard drive worked fine for him and his children.
